Today marked the 19th anniversary of the TWA Flight 800 crash. The ceremony was held in the evening for family and friends of the victims at the memorial at Smith Point. The Paris-bound TWA Flight 800 had just taken off from Kennedy Airport when it exploded at 8:31 p.m. July 16, 1996 and plunged into […]

By Kyle Campbell Despite burning to the ground eight months earlier in one of the biggest Dune Road blazes in decades, the Cupsogue Beach County Park Beach Hut opened its doors on Friday afternoon for its 17th season at the county-run park. A temporary beach hut consisting of a 38-foot mobile kitchen parked alongside a […]
